  Job Summary:

  The Information Systems Security Manager (ISSM)will have primary ownership of Information Systems under their assigned purview. They are responsible for overseeing and implementing the Cybersecurity Program established by the Cybersecurity Lead and in accordance with the National Industrial Security Program Operating Manual (NISPOM), DoD Special Access Program (SAP) Security Manuals, Risk Management Framework (RMF), Intelligence Community Directive (ICD-503), Joint Special Access Program (SAP) Implementation Guide (JSIG), Defense Counter-Intelligence Security Agency (DCSA) Assessment and Authorization Process Manual (DAAPM), associated National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ST), along with any additional customer directives and company policies as applicable.

  Cybersecurity Managers provide leadership, guidance, and direction to enable business execution in a secure operating environment. They are the Cybersecurity focal point for the program with early PMO engagement, awareness and centralized classified cybersecurity support to the acquisition lifecycle.

  The Information Systems Security Manager coordinates directly with local cognizant security agency (CSA) representatives on Cybersecurity requirements, guidance, and approvals. They possess both a broad technical and programmatic expertise while simultaneously demonstrating excellent interpersonal skill to deal with internal as well as external interfaces..

  The ISSM is responsible for various site activities associated with Cybersecurity to include clearance verification/access management, training, and performance and development actions within their purview.
